Forum: Mikrocontroller und Digitale Elektronik Atmega 32 Portb.1


von Christian B. (chris001)


Lesenswert?

Hallo Leute!

Hab da mal ne Frage.

Hier ein kleines Testprogramm in Bascom:

$regfile = "m32def.dat"
$crystal = 16000000
$hwstack = 100
$swstack = 100
$framesize = 100

'DP unten links
Dpul Alias Portb.3
Config Dpul = Output

'DP oben links
Dpol Alias Portb.2
Config Dpol = Output

'DP unten rechts
'Dpur Alias Portb.1
'Config Dpur = Output

'DP oben rechts
Dpor Alias Portb.0
Config Dpor = Output

Do

'Dpur = 1
Portb.1 = 1
Portb.0 = 1
Wait 2

'Dpur = 0
Portb.1 = 0
Portb.0 = 0
Wait 2

Loop
End

An den Ports ist jeweils eine LED angeschlossen. Nur die LED an dem 
Portb.1 funktioniert nicht, wenn ich den Alias ausklammer und verwende.
Schreibe ich in der Endlosschleife Portb.1 = 1 (s. Beispiel) 
funktioniert alles.

Warum?

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.